Uses of Bivicip AG


Bivicip AG is a prescription drug prescribed by a doctor, made in the form of long film-coated tablets. Adhering to the indications, the dose of Bivicip AG will help patients improve the effectiveness of treatment and avoid unwanted side effects.

1. What is Bivicip AG?


Bivicip AG medicine contains the following ingredients and excipients:
Ingredients: Ciprofloxacin (in the form of Ciprofloxacin Hydrochloride) content 500mg; Excipients: Sodium Starch Glycolat, Povidone, Microcrystalline Cellulose, Anhydrous Colloidal Silicon Dioxide, Hydroxypropyl Methylcellulose, Titanium Dioxide, Magnesium Stearate, Polyethylene Glycol 6000 and purified water just enough for 1 tablet. Bivicip AG has 4 packaging forms including:
Box of 5 blisters x 10 tablets of Bivicip AG; Box of 10 blisters x 10 tablets of Bivicip AG; Box of 1 bottle of 100 Bivicip AG tablets; Bottle of 500 tablets Bivicip AG.

2. Uses of the drug Bivicip AG


Bivicip AG is used to treat infections caused by sensitive bacteria such as:
Urinary tract infections; Chronic prostatitis; Lower respiratory tract infections caused by Gram-negative bacteria; Acute sinusitis ; Skin and soft tissue infections; Bone and joint infections; Diarrhea caused by infection; Typhoid fever. Uncomplicated gonorrhea of ​​the cervix and urethra.

3. Contraindications of Bivicip AG


Bivicip AG is contraindicated in the following cases:
People with a history of hypersensitivity to Ciprofloxacin components or excipients in Bivicip AG and Quinolone antibiotics; Women who are pregnant or breastfeeding; Children < 18 years old.

4. Dosage and how to use Bivicip AG


How to use: Bivicip AG is taken orally. Patients should take Bivicip AG with a full glass of water, 2 hours after eating.
Dosage:
Treatment of urinary tract infections:
Mild, moderate or uncomplicated cases: Dose 250mg x 2 times/day. Treatment for about 3-7 days; Severe cases and complications: Dose 500mg x 2 times/day. Treatment within 14 days. Treatment of chronic prostatitis:
Mild or moderate disease: Dose 500mg x 2 times/day. Treatment within 28 days. Treatment of lower respiratory tract infections:
Mild, moderate or uncomplicated cases: Dose 500mg x 2 times/day. Treatment within 7 days; Severe cases and complications: Dose 750mg x 2 times/day. Treatment within 14 days. Treatment of acute sinusitis:
Mild and moderate cases: Dose 500mg x 2 times/day. Treatment within 10 days. Treatment of skin and soft tissue infections:
Mild, moderate or uncomplicated cases: Dose 500mg x 2 times/day. Treatment within 7 days; Severe cases and complications: Dose 750mg x 2 times/day. Treatment within 14 days. Treatment of bone and joint infections:
Mild, moderate or uncomplicated cases: Dose 500mg x 2 times/day. Treatment for 4 weeks; Severe cases and complications: Dose 750mg x 2 times/day. Treatment within 6 weeks. Treatment of diarrhea caused by infections:
Mild to severe cases: Dose 500mg x 2 times/day. Treatment within 5-7 days. Treatment of typhoid fever:
Mild to moderate cases: Dose 500mg x 2 times/day. Treatment for 10 days. Treatment of urethral and cervical gonorrhea:
Uncomplicated: 500mg single dose. Note: Dosage adjustment is required in patients with renal impairment.

5. Side effects of the drug Bivicip AG


Using Bivicip AG can cause some unwanted effects in the organ systems such as:
Digestive system: Abdominal pain, nausea/vomiting, indigestion, diarrhea and pseudomembranous colitis. Central nervous system: Dizziness, headache, hallucinations, insomnia, psychosis, depression, visual disturbances, nightmares and convulsions. Skin: Pruritus, erythema, vasculitis, Steven Johnson syndrome, erythema multiforme and photosensitivity. Systemic anaphylactic reaction. Eosinophilia, thrombocytopenia, leukopenia, hemolytic anemia (very rare) and agranulocytosis. Temporarily increased serum creatinine, bilirubin and urea. Jaundice, elevated liver enzymes and hepatitis. Renal failure, crystalluria, interstitial nephritis and hematuria. Heart beats fast. Joint discomfort, Achilles tendonitis, and muscle pain. The effects of Bivicip AG are usually mild and moderate. However, serious side effects of Bivicip AG can still occur, so it should not be subjective. If you experience these symptoms, the patient should stop using Bivicip AG and notify the doctor for appropriate treatment.

6. Be careful when using Bivicip AG


Be careful when using Bivicip AG for people with a history of central nervous system disorders, epilepsy, impaired liver and kidney function, G6PD deficiency and myasthenia gravis. Long-term use of Bivicip AG may cause overgrowth of susceptible bacteria. In this case, it is necessary to have an antibiotic chart and appropriate treatment measures. Patients should limit exposure to sunlight and ultraviolet rays during treatment with Bivicip AG. If photosensitivity occurs, Bivicip AG should be discontinued. It is not recommended to use Bivicip AG for children from 1 to 17 years old because it can cause cartilage degeneration. Elderly people with impaired liver and kidney function need to adjust the dose of Bivicip AG accordingly. Bivicip AG can cause side effects such as dizziness, lightheadedness, so it should be used with caution when used by people who drive and operate machinery.

7. How to handle missed dose, overdose Bivicip AG


Missed dose:
In case of missing dose of Bivicip AG, it is advisable to supplement as soon as possible. However, if it is almost time for the next dose, skip the missed dose of Bivicip AG and use a new dose. Overdosage:
When Bivicip AG overdose is used, it can cause headache, drowsiness, disorientation, abdominal pain, dizziness, slurred speech, nausea/vomiting, tremors, diarrhea and problems. about the kidney. Patients need to stop the drug immediately and go to the nearest medical facility for timely treatment.
